作为一个嵌入式开发的初学者,花了俩星期时间,终于让跑Linux系统的IMX6开发板换上了新的屏幕。 这里,移植屏幕的主要思路就是: 1. 确保连线正确; 2. 学习LCD液晶屏的时序(在修改参数时需要); 3. 看懂屏幕的数据手册(各种数据手册对同一个现象的写法不一样); 4. 修改uboot和(内 ...
分类:
其他好文 时间:
2018-12-06 22:12:52
阅读次数:
274
RAM 映射 36×4 LCD 显示驱动器
概述
HT9B92 是一款存储器映射和多功能LCD控制驱动芯片。该芯片显示模式有144 点(36×4 )。 HT9B92 软件配置特性使得它适用于多种LCD应用,包括LCD 模块和显示子系统。HT9B92 通过双线双向 I2C 接口与大多数微处理器/ 微控制器进行通信。
分类:
其他好文 时间:
2018-12-06 20:44:36
阅读次数:
386
1 #include "lcd.h" //调用LCD.h函数 2 #include "stdlib.h" 3 #include "font.h" 4 #include "usart.h" //调用usart.h函数 5 #include "delay.h" //调用delay.h函数 6 ... ...
分类:
其他好文 时间:
2018-12-06 20:29:04
阅读次数:
434
title: LCD学习 tags: ARM date: 2018 10 28 20:18:48:59 [TOC] 引入 裸屏,也就是最终接口是RGB的信号线,需要MCU支持液晶驱动或者MCU连接液晶驱动芯片 在JZ2440连接的就是裸屏,接口一般如下: 带驱动芯片的液晶模块,类似STM32就是这么 ...
分类:
其他好文 时间:
2018-11-27 01:26:42
阅读次数:
215
title: mmu tags: ARM date: 2018 11 05 20:22:59 原因 1. 让APP可以以同样的链接地址来编译,这样虽然是同样的链接地址,实际会映射到不同的实际地址(具体可以通过不同的pid)对应到不同的地址 2. 让大容量APP可以在资源少的系统上运行,也就是先加载部 ...
分类:
其他好文 时间:
2018-11-27 01:21:13
阅读次数:
204
iPhone新一代已经上市,也是沿袭了上一代的图片格式,不仅有最先进的LCD显示屏,最智能的芯片以及面容ID等等,确实是又一震惊的举动,对于上一代沿袭的照片格式也是特殊的存在,因为目前在其他系统还未普及,但是这种格式在电脑和安卓手机中打不开,这就给很多iPhone用户带来了不便,那如果想在电脑上打开这种格式怎么办呢?1、在电脑上打开这种格式并不是没有办法,可以将图片格式进行转换,转换成电脑上可以打
分类:
其他好文 时间:
2018-11-19 20:02:06
阅读次数:
473
一:前言目前网上有很多的Openldap服务端搭建教程,但是大部分其实都还是6的部署过程,许多朋友在centos7下按照网上的文档进行部署,会发现根本没有主配置文件,加上我自己踩过的一些坑,在这篇文档里,我把centos7下部署Openldap的过程再梳理一遍。二:知识准备1:根据我最近学习到的,我认为ldap就是一个账户认证服务,通过单服务端多客户端的方式,每新增一个客户端服务器,都可以简单的通
分类:
其他好文 时间:
2018-11-19 11:09:24
阅读次数:
233
Android的休眠唤醒主要基于wake_lock机制,只要系统中存在任一有效的wake_lock,系统就不能进入深度休眠,但可以进行设备的浅度休眠操作。wake_lock一般在关闭lcd、tp但系统仍然需要正常运行的情况下使用,比如听歌、传输很大的文件等。本文主要分析driver层wake_loc ...
分类:
移动开发 时间:
2018-11-19 11:04:19
阅读次数:
213
1. clock frequency PeriodHS PeriodVS rate 2. x+y+z=280 3. x+y+z=20 ...
分类:
其他好文 时间:
2018-11-15 12:01:13
阅读次数:
140
有时候需要将开机启动的信息输出到LCD上,并且在终端上进行调试。本文记录更改的方法。 参考链接 uboot uboot bootargs添加console=tty0 如下,debug信息即会在lcd输出,也会输出到LCD。 setenv bootargs console=tty0 console=t ...
分类:
系统相关 时间:
2018-11-14 14:25:43
阅读次数:
414